[News] Linux-based Portable Media Player Reviewed

Review: Archos Media Player Delivers

,----[ Quote ]
| If Apple's iPod is the nicely tuned Porsche of portable media players and 
| Microsoft's Zune is the Jetta, then a new Wi-Fi-enabled unit from Archos is
| the Hummer, a brutish performer with all the tools to navigate the rugged 
| terrain of technology needs on the go.
`----

TurboLinux Device May Jump-Start OS Migration

,----[ Quote ]
| When the Wizpy USB device boots up, it tricks the computer into seeing it 
| as a CD-ROM drive, which enables the Linux kernel to run instead of, say, 
| Windows or Mac OS. All OS settings and users' documents remain within 
| Wizpy, leaving no record or file imprint behind on the host computer's hard 
| drive.
`----
